The operating environment of the Wired Remote I/O System can have a large
effect on the longevity and reliability of the system. Improper operating environ-
ments can lead to malfunction, failure, and other unforeseeable problems with
the System. Be sure that the operating environment is within the specified condi-
tions at installation and remains within the specified conditions during the life of
the System.
Observe the following precautions when using the Wired Remote I/O System.
Always heed these precautions. Failure to abide by the following precautions
could lead to serious or possibly fatal injury.
Emergency stop circuits, interlock circuits, limit circuits, and similar safety
measures must be provided in external control circuits.
The PC will turn OFF all outputs when its self-diagnosis function detects any
error or when a severe failure alarm (FALS) instruction is executed. As a coun-
termeasure for such errors, external safety measures must be provided to en-
sure safety in the system.
The PC outputs may remain ON or OFF due to deposition or burning of the
output relays or destruction of the output transistors. As a countermeasure for
such problems, external safety measures must be provided to ensure safety in
the system.
